Former Baylor quarterback Jarrett Stidham is one of the hottest players on the transfer market right now.

Several SEC schools have been reportedly courting the former 4-star prospect, including Auburn, Florida and Texas A&M. It makes sense for each of those schools to want Stidham on campus, only it appears the Aggies are no longer interested.

Speaking with Bleacher Report, Stidham indicated that he and Texas A&M have not had much communication recently.

“A&M, they’ve had a good year,” Stidham told Bleacher Report. “I haven’t talked to them much lately. I don’t know what’s been going on. I just haven’t really talked to them much lately. We’ll just kind of see how things continue to go.”

That’s big news for Florida and Auburn, who now appear to be the frontrunners for the quarterback’s services. As a freshman, Stidham threw for 1,265 yards with 12 touchdowns and 2 interceptions while mostly coming off the bench for Baylor.
